Introduction
Located in the northern part of Istanbul, the Rumeli Kavağı Fortifications are a historic site that offers breathtaking views of the Bosphorus. Built in the 15th century, these fortifications held significant strategic importance during the Ottoman era. Today, they have become a popular destination for both history buffs and nature enthusiasts.
Features
The Rumeli Kavağı Fortifications stand out with their impressive walls and historical structures. Inside the fortifications, you'll find walking paths, resting areas, and various picnic spots. Additionally, they provide an excellent vantage point to enjoy the unique scenery of the Bosphorus. The site is also home to numerous bird species, making it an ideal location for nature watchers.
